Join us at Salotto for a curated screening of five exceptional short films from Sardinia, showcasing the island's vibrant culture and its emerging cinematic talent.
Visioni Sarde was born in 2014 within the historic festival “Visioni Italiane”, created by the critics and experts of the Cineteca di Bologna to narrate Sardinia through cinema. Over the years, the festival has captured the attention of the public, industry professionals, and critics for the quality of the selected works and for its focus on new trends, offering the filmmakers the opportunity to reach the widest possible national and international audience.
The titles screened at Salotto will be:
Tilipirche, (18′) by Francesco Piras
Spiaggia libera, (14′) by Ludovica Zedda
Incappucciati, foschi, (16′) by Nicola Camoglio
Senza te (Without you), (13′) by Sergio Falchi
Santamaria, (18′) by Andrea Deidda
The short movies will be introduced by Valeria Orani, Curator Creative Producer, and President of the Community Disterra.US
The screening will be the first of Lacanalzu (Neighbors), a series of events to celebrate Sardinia across the U.S. The upcoming screenings of the Visioni Sarde film festival will take place in May at the Italian Cultural Institute of New York and San Francisco.
